Comparison In 2022,  South Sudan ranked 168 in total exports ($544M), and does not have data regarding Economic Complexity Index. That same year, Uruguay ranked 57 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 0.15), and 98 in total exports ($12B).

This map shows whether countries import more from South Sudan or Uruguay. Each country is colored based on the difference in imports they receive from South Sudan and Uruguay or the difference in the growth in imports.

In 2022, countries that imported more from South Sudan than Uruguay included United Arab Emirates ($45.5M), Rwanda ($278k), and Tanzania ($21.1k).

In 2022, countries that imported more from Uruguay than South Sudan included China ($2.89B), Brazil ($1.69B), and Argentina ($999M).
